I've had it 3 times now. The computer totaly locks up...
Can't do anything without a hard-reset. (on/off power :)
I used a clean 2.2.5 kernel that came with RedHat.
I use the server as an ftp mainly with a lot of i/o on the HD ;-)
I have two 16 GB HD on the server. (IDE)
No SCSI at all in the kernel.
Now I have uppgraded to 2.3.26 and I'll get back to you if I get it
again.
When I do a cat /proc/ioports i get:
e000-e00f : VIA Technologies VT 82C586 Apollo IDE
Could it be the VIA chip that's causing all the trouble?
I know Cox and the others are working on it :)
